10PCS/LOT NEW LM2664M6X LM2664M6 LM2664 MARKING S03A.LM2665M6X LM2665M6 LM2665 S04A SOT23-6

10PCS/LOT NEW LM2664M6X LM2664M6 LM2664 MARKING S03A.LM2665M6X LM2665M6 LM2665 S04A SOT23-6
thumb
thumb
sku: 4000838496323
$3.44-1%
$3.40
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ed